DENVER – University of Denver hockey freshmen
Zeev Buium and
Sam Harris have been recognized by the National Collegiate Hockey Conference with Player of the Week awards. Buium is the NCHC Defenseman of the Week while Harris was selected as the NCHC Rookie of the Week.
The rookies helped a balanced Pioneer attack that had 11 different goal scorers over the weekend and outscored then-No. 15 St. Cloud State Huskies 13-4 overall. DU won 6-2 on Friday and 7-2 on Saturday to earn its first weekend sweep at St. Cloud since Dec. 7-8, 2007.
Buium combined for three assists and a plus-seven rating in Denver's two wins. He had an assist, two penalty minutes and had a plus-three rating on Friday before contributing two helpers on Saturday for his 10th multi-point game and seventh multi-assist outing of the season. He finished the series finale with a game-high, plus-four rating (tied) and two blocked shots.
The San Diego, California, native has 41 points on the season, ranking fifth among all freshmen and first for all defensemen in the nation in scoring. His 32 assists are fifth overall in the NCAA and most among all D-men.
This is Buium's fourth conference weekly award of the season, and his third top defenseman honor (also Nov. 27, Jan. 22). He was named Rookie of the Week on Dec. 4.
Harris earned his first career NCHC weekly award after scoring twice on Friday at St. Cloud State for his second multi-goal game of the campaign, and he tallied his first career game-winning goal in contest. He had his career-long, four-game goal and five-game goal streak (six goals, one assist) come to an end on Saturday after being held off the scoresheet.
Also from San Diego, California, Harris is sixth on the team with 11 goals and has also added three assists for 14 points this season. He is the fifth different Denver freshmen to be selected as an NCHC Rookie of the Week; the Pioneers have won 20 total conference weekly honors in 2023-24.
North Dakota picked up the other two honors, as Owen McLaughlin was selected as Forward of the Week and Ludvig Persson was chosen as Goaltender of the Week. Denver sophomore
Aidan Thompson (forward) and junior
Matt Davis (goaltender) were award finalists this week.
